summaryrefslogtreecommitdiffstats
path: root/Makefile.in
diff options
context:
space:
mode:
authorMarc Kleine-Budde <mkl@pengutronix.de>2010-04-01 21:22:49 +0200
committerMarc Kleine-Budde <mkl@pengutronix.de>2010-04-02 00:01:59 +0200
commit67777899db111e0b721b96cff1b53c3d4158e0ee (patch)
tree7f9f9719b4171506c4aa3ad742895ba99c907a3a /Makefile.in
parent0e3d25ce4349c5bf34c38eb7253fa74a03ee03bf (diff)
downloadptxdist-67777899db111e0b721b96cff1b53c3d4158e0ee.tar.gz
ptxdist-67777899db111e0b721b96cff1b53c3d4158e0ee.tar.xz
[Makefile.in] only install bash completion if dest is writable
Signed-off-by: Marc Kleine-Budde <mkl@pengutronix.de>
Diffstat (limited to 'Makefile.in')
-rw-r--r--Makefile.in6
1 files changed, 4 insertions, 2 deletions
diff --git a/Makefile.in b/Makefile.in
index e8c80188f..881e20000 100644
--- a/Makefile.in
+++ b/Makefile.in
@@ -55,8 +55,10 @@ install: all
@rm -f "$(DESTDIR)$(bindir)/ptxdist"
@ln -sf "$(instdir)/bin/ptxdist" "$(DESTDIR)$(bindir)/ptxdist-$(version)"
@ln -sf "$(instdir)/bin/ptxdist" "$(DESTDIR)$(bindir)/ptxdist"
- -@[ -d "$(DESTDIR)@BASH_COMPLETION_DIR@" ] && \
- cp scripts/bash_completion "$(DESTDIR)@BASH_COMPLETION_DIR@/ptxdist"
+ @if [ -d "$(DESTDIR)@BASH_COMPLETION_DIR@" -a \
+ -w "$(DESTDIR)@BASH_COMPLETION_DIR@" ]; then \
+ cp scripts/bash_completion "$(DESTDIR)@BASH_COMPLETION_DIR@/ptxdist"; \
+ fi
clean:
@rm -f .done